What is Don Julio Pink Lemonade?
Don Julio Pink Lemonade is a refreshing cocktail that combines Don Julio tequila, often the Rosado variety, which features a subtle pink hue, with pink lemonade to create a vibrant and delicious drink.
Ingredients:
- 2 oz Don Julio Rosado (or Don Julio Blanco) Tequila: (Don Julio Rosado is preferred for its delicate pink hue and smoothness, but Blanco works in a pinch!)
- 4 oz Pink Lemonade: (Store-bought or homemade, a good quality pink lemonade makes all the difference here.)
- Splash of Triple Sec or Orange Liqueur (optional, for a citrusy kick)
- 1/2 oz Fresh Lemon Juice (for added tartness)
- Ice
- Fresh Strawberries or Lemon Slices (for garnish)
- Mint Leaves (optional, for extra freshness)
Instructions:
- Prepare Your Glass: Fill a highball or cocktail glass with ice to chill it while you prepare the drink.
- Mix It Up: In a cocktail shaker, combine the Don Julio Rosado, pink lemonade, fresh lemon juice, and a splash of triple sec (if using). Add a handful of ice. Secure the lid.
- Shake: Shake vigorously for 10-15 seconds. This not only chills the drink but really helps blend those flavors.
- Pour & Garnish: Dump the ice from your prepared glass, then strain your cocktail mixture into the glass over fresh ice. Garnish with strawberry slices, a lemon wheel, and mint leaves for a pop of color and fragrance.
Tips For The Best Don Julio Pink Lemonade:
- Homemade Pink Lemonade: If you have a few extra minutes, try making pink lemonade from scratch with fresh lemon juice, sugar, water, and a splash of cranberry or raspberry juice for color and flavor.
- Adjust Sweetness: Like your drinks less sweet? Reduce the amount of pink lemonade or add a bit more lemon juice.
- Make it a Batch: Hosting a party? Scale up the recipe and mix it in a large pitcher for easy pouring.
- Mocktail Version: Skip the tequila and triple sec, use soda water for fizz, still delicious and refreshing!
- Customize Your Garnish: Feeling fancy? Rim your glass with sugar for extra sparkle.
What To Serve Don Julio Pink Lemonade With
Fresh, Light Appetizers:
- Shrimp Cocktail: The citrusy pink lemonade cuts through the richness of cold, plump shrimp and spicy cocktail sauce.
- Ceviche: Bright seafood dishes with lime juice and herbs echo the punchy citrus of your drink.
- Guacamole & Chips: Creamy guacamole with a sprinkle of chili pairs well with the tequila and citrus combo.
Fruity Or Citrus Salads:
- Watermelon & Feta Salad: The sweet watermelon and salty feta complement the tangy notes of pink lemonade.
- Citrus Avocado Salad: The layers of grapefruit, orange, and creamy avocado harmonize with your cocktail’s flavors.
- Berry Spinach Salad: Strawberries, blueberries, or raspberries, plus some nuts and goat cheese, are fresh and festive.
Tacos And Finger Foods:
- Fish Tacos: Lightly battered fish, crunchy slaw, and a squeeze of lime are almost made for a tequila-based drink.
- Chicken or Veggie Skewers: Grilled skewers with a squeeze of lemon or lime are easy, crowd-pleasing, and pair perfectly.
- Mini Quesadillas: Cheese, peppers, and your favorite fillings in a bite-sized format.
Brunch Favorites:
- Avocado Toast: The creamy, savory flavors work nicely with the lemonade’s tartness.
- Egg Bites or Mini Frittatas: Make-ahead, easy to eat, and would fit a brunch vibe.
- Fruit Platter: Offer fresh berries, melon, and citrus segments for guests to nibble.
Sweet Treats:
- Lemon Bars or Pink Lemonade Cupcakes: Echo the drink’s flavors with citrus desserts.
- Fresh Strawberries Dipped in Chocolate: Simple, elegant, and perfect for a pink-themed party.
- Sorbet or Granita: Lemon or berry flavours are incredible and cleansing, matching the cocktail’s refreshment.
Substitute Ingredients
Tequila Substitutes:
- Any Reposado or Blanco Tequila: Brands like Espolon, Casamigos, Patron, or Milagro have smooth profiles. Reposado gives a softer, slightly oakier flavor; Blanco is crisp and bright.
- Pink-Hued Tequilas: If you still want some color, look for brands offering tequila finished in wine or port barrels, such as Codigo 1530 Rosa or Gran Centenario Rosangel.
Pink Lemonade Substitutes:
- Homemade Pink Lemonade: Mix fresh lemon juice, simple syrup (or sugar), water, and a splash of cranberry, raspberry, or pomegranate juice for color and flavor.
- Regular Lemonade + Fruit Juice: Combine standard lemonade with a small amount of the above juices to get that pink color.
- Sparkling Lemonade: Use sparkling lemonade for a fizzy twist, or combine still lemonade with club soda.
Triple Sec Or Orange Liqueur Substitute:
- Cointreau, Grand Marnier, or Combier: Any orange liqueur works if you have it.
- Orange Juice: Use a splash of orange juice for a more natural citrus kick.
- Omit It: Skip the liqueur entirely, your drink will still taste great!
Fresh Lemon Juice Substitute:
- Lime Juice: Similar tartness, just a different citrus character.
- Bottled Lemon Juice: Use in a pinch, but fresh is best for flavor.
Garnish Options:
- Other Berries: Blueberries, raspberries, or blackberries look and taste great.
- Citrus Wedges: Lime or orange slices or twists as a colorful accent.
- Herbs: Swap mint with basil or rosemary for an aromatic twist.
